Crime overview

Lumley Walk area has the 38th highest crime rate of 114 local areas in Kirkstall , and the 966th highest crime rate of 2,526 local areas in Leeds .

At least one of the neighbouring streets has high or very high crime levels. However, overall crime around this postcode is more mixed, with some nearby areas experiencing lower cr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around Lumley Walk (LS4 2NR) in the last 12 months was 106.7 per 1,000 residents and was 21.5% lower than the Kirkstall average (135.9 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 9 offences recorded. The least common crime was Bicycle theft with 1 case , up 100.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Criminal damage and arson ( 500.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Anti-social behaviour ( -25.0%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 12 (≈ 36.6 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-14.3%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-50.5%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Lumley Walk (LS4 2NR),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Argie Terrace, where police recorded 61 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Vinery Road (18 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
